Are feathers better than Vanes?
Feathers usually are longer than vanes, which makes them prone to wind drift when shooting at long distances. Vanes are more durable and water-resistant than feathers, making them popular with bowhunters for enduring wet weather and abuse from brush. According to Arnold, vanes come in a variety of shapes and sizes.
How much do 4 inch feathers weigh?
Sizes
| Size | Average Weight | Height in Inches |
|---|---|---|
| 3 1/2″ Batwing | 2.04 Grains ea. | 0.551 in. |
| 3″ Shield | 2.21 Grains ea. | 0.629 in. |
| 4″ Parabolic | 2.76 Grains ea. | 0.610 in. |
| 4″ Shield | 2.95 Grains ea. | 0.610 in. |
Are turkey feathers good for arrows?
Wild turkey feathers are sturdier and more water resistant than feathers from farm-raised turkeys. They are untreated, meaning they retain their natural oils. Secondary flight feathers are just inside from the primary feathers and are shorter, but still usable feathers for fletching arrows.
What are the best carbon arrows for hunting?
Carbon Hunting Arrow Reviews. Carbon arrows are by far the most popular type of arrows in use today. The best arrows are advertised to have straightness tolerances from 0.001 to 0.006 inches, and naturally the straighter the arrows the more expensive they will be.
What are the feathers of an arrow called?
Fletching is made up of three or more vanes or feathers. One of the feathers will be a different color and is called the “cock” feather. The remaining feathers are referred to as the “hen” feathers. Arrowhead: The point of the arrow.
